2015: Jonathan’s posters flood Akure

In spite of the warning given by the Independent National Electoral Commission over syndication of campaign posters ahead of the 2015 General elections, colourfully printed campaign posters of President Goodluck Jonathan has flooded some areas in Akure, the Ondo State capital.

The posters which captured the president, wearing different caps from the three main ethnics groups in the country were pasted majorly along the express way.

Although those behind the pasting of the posters were still unknown, it was gathered that they were pasted in the midnight.

President Jonathan’s posters were the first to flood some streets in Akure in the battle ahead of 2015 presidential election.

However, the state chapter of the People’s Democratic Party has distanced itself from the mass pasting of the posters.

Its state Chairman, Ebenezer Alabi alleged that the opposition parties were behind the action.
